It's important to work closely with your doctor and other members of your health care team to create the best treatment plan for you or the person … WebThe Mediterranean and MIND diets and Alzheimer’s. One diet that shows some promising evidence is the Mediterranean diet, which emphasizes fruits, vegetables, whole grains, legumes, fish, and other seafood; unsaturated fats such as olive oils; and low amounts of red meat, eggs, and sweets. Web5 frequently asked questions about Alzheimer’s and dementia. 1. What’s the difference between Alzheimer’s and dementia? Dementia is a broad term that describes changes in the brain’s ability to process information. Alzheimer’s is a form of dementia. It’s the most common type and accounts for 60 – 80% of all dementia cases.
